Microsoft Displaces Salesforce at HP in One of Largest-Ever Dynamics CRM Online Deals

by Jason Gumpert
Editor, MSDynamicsWorld.com

Microsoft's Satya Nadella and HP's Dion Weisler 

Microsoft has announced a major win for Dynamics CRM Online at HP Inc. that displaces Salesforce. The six-year agreement will deploy Dynamics to thousands of HP employees.

The win also includes new commitment by HP to Microsoft Azure, Office 365 and other Microsoft Cloud solutions for sales and service collaboration. Microsoft told partners in July at WPC 2016 that the deal  (at that time un-announced) would be one of its largest ever CRM wins.

For HP, the move to Dynamics CRM Online and other Microsoft cloud services is part of its "journey to transform its sales and partner environment," the company noted in a statement. That transformation includes a more integrated sales experience.

HP will be moving to the Dynamics solution over the next 18 months, giving them a single system for sales and support, HP chief operating officer Jon Flaxman said today at the HP Global Partnership Conference.

"We have chosen Microsoft Dynamics as our CRM solution for our direct selling, partners and services," said Flaxman. "This brings us a cloud-based solution that delivers a more effective and efficient collaboration engine across our business."

"The benefits were compelling for us and our partners. It offers a more integrated sale," he continued. Mobility is key to HP, and the Dynamics solution will also incorporate HP balance and trade information, which sales reps didn't have in the past.

"Instead of funnel management, we are implementing a sales collaboration tool," he said.
